Surveying Details H5848/17 28.9.17 POSN 540030N, 000450E OR 0.75 MILES W OF A BUOY. (VAEC). 10.4.24 AMEND OLD WK SYMBOL IN 540030N, 000450E TO DW. BR STD. H3752/26 11.6.26 AMEND TO NDW. POSN 535900, 000400E. SANK IN 2MIN. (PILOT'S REPORT). H5084/77 21.3.80 WK EXAM'D 28.11.79 IN 540145.6N, 000306.0E [OGB] USING HIFIX/6 [2 LOP]. LEAST E/S DEPTH 32 IN GEN DEPTH 38.7MTRS. SCOUR 0.5MTR DEEP. DCS3 HT 5.1MTRS, LENGTH 80MTRS. LYING 120/300DEG. IN TWO MAIN SECTIONS. (HMS ECHO, HI 64/79). BR STD. H2534/74 9.1.80 WK REPD IN 540142N, 000259E. POSN BY DECCA. (KINGFISHER BOOK OF TOWS, VOL I). NCA. HH100/351/17 30.8.01 THIS IS THE VILLE DE VALENCIENNES. HER BELL WAS RECOVERED RECENTLY. (R YOUNG, EMAIL DTD 6.8.01), NCA. HH100/351/18 8.4.02 WELL BROKEN UP. ENGINE AND TWO BOILERS MIDSHIPS. GUN ON STERN WAS RECOVERED IN 1985. BOWS S. SEABED SAND AND GRAVEL. IDENTIFIED FROM BELL INSCRIBED: VILLE DE VALENCIENNES, DUNKIRK, 1897. (A C JACKSON & C A RACEY). NCA. SEP2016/000053291 10.3.16 EXAM'D 10.3.16; IN 5401.782N, 0002.981E [WGD]. LEAST WCD DEPTH 30.53MTRS, GEN DEPTH 37MTRS. LENGTH 101.8MTRS, WIDTH 18.7MTRS, HT 5.09MTRS, ORIENTATION 112/292 DEGS. STRONG MAGNETIC ANOMALY, WK PARTIALLY INTACT. (MMT, HI 1473, H525_6469). AMEND NDW 30.5MTRS IN REVISED POSN.

Circumstances of loss

BUILT IN 1897 BY J READHEAD & SONS, SOUTH SHIELDS. OWNED AT TIME OF LOSS BY CIE DES BATEAUX A VAPEUR DU NORD. TWO BOILERS, TRIPLE EXPANSION ENGINE OF 234HP, SINGLE SHAFT. PASSAGE THE TYNE FOR BORDEAUX. CARGO COAL. TORPEDOED AND SUNK.
